63:
112:
324:, which... counts the occurrences of each month name in the edit box... and then outputs them as a tab-separated list to the edit summary box). But maybe there will be a few bangers, in which case it'd still require going to their talk page to ask first (I certainly don't want my most dogshit code being shown to the world without my knowledge lol).
838:
Thanks for the post-publishing! My idea for /Improve was to have anyone who wanted someone to do something to add that something there and only remove it when done or something new needs to replace it, since my interpretation of the section was just soliciting work from the community. Basically your
284:
to get the first revision timestamp for each page and then sort by that. I dunno if this would give us anything good, but maybe there'd be a bunch of good stuff, and then we could go to people's talk pages and say "this script looks cool, can we put it in the newsletter?"
486:, opt-out added. Just out of curiosity, any particular reason you don't want your scripts categorized? If they're just for personal use or a specific task only you perform I'd imagine you wouldn't use the infobox to begin with. —
464:
Oh yeah, I don't like it. I certainly didn't intend my scripts end up in that category. Make it optional, or at the very least provide an opt-out. If you want to know which pages use the infobox, why can't you just search with
500:
Well, I'm realizing I didn't want my scripts in that category precisely because it was voluntary and scarcely populated. It seemed pointless. Now that it's automatic I don't really mind it, admittedly.
738:
I've changed the shell so that pages only get put into that category if the title isn't "Knowledge:Scripts++/Next" and removed the category from the archive. Hopefully this'll take effect soon.
320:
Yeah, my estimate is that probably 80% of these will be someone copy-pasting an existing script into a fork, 15% goofy things that someone wrote for their own extremely narrow use case (like
193:
173:
264:
269:
This is probably dumb and wouldn't work, but I bet it'd be possible to write something in Quarry that found new userscripts that were large enough to do something, like:
423:
306:, interesting idea, though we should keep in mind that many scripts weren't written for any wider audience, they could be things that only work well for the author. —
546:
272:
SELECT page_title, page_len, page_latest FROM page WHERE page_title LIKE '%.js' AND page_title NOT like '%/common.js' AND page_is_redirect = 0 AND page_len : -->
541:
245:
572:
Late by a lot, but I don't think so. I think users should be reviewing scripts in a bit more detail before installing them, unlike the approach at US/L.
297:
259:
402:
I made the infobox categorize so now my scripts (and another 200+ scripts that have the infobox but lacked the category) are in there. For example
459:
435:
715:
510:
495:
362:
336:
315:
478:
814:
759:
381:
583:
605:
394:
719:
400:(which not even every script has) doesn't categorize so that'll probably miss a lot. At least my scripts aren't in there atm.
566:
79:
749:
733:
850:
631:
221:
217:
213:
209:
205:
201:
197:
189:
185:
181:
177:
169:
165:
161:
833:
785:
709:
615:
157:
153:
149:
145:
141:
137:
133:
129:
125:
693:
677:
534:* {{userscript | code= User:Example/example.js |name= example |doc= User:Example/example |noref=yes}} – Description.
796:
589:
795:
since the contents were sent out in Issue 25. However, it could be argued that this page should be kept as it was
415:
407:
40:
698:
Okay, these were sent out again, along with the archives page. Hmm. I'll see if that talk page has any answers.
769:
773:
673:
792:
777:
761:
659:
403:
45:
419:
250:
Once scripts are added to an issue, the discussion here will be moved to that issue's talk page. Thanks, --
781:
666:
643:
411:
367:
321:
594:
I remember there being a list somewhere of all the scripts that have been featured. Any idea where?
678:
https://en.wikipedia.org/search/?title=Knowledge:Scripts%2B%2B/Next&feed=rss&action=history
526:
445:
357:
846:
745:
729:
705:
665:
I'm not sure the information about this is available on enwiki. It might be better to ask at
601:
579:
491:
431:
311:
30:
8:
255:
829:
810:
689:
676:
the feed seems to be constructed from RSS. The only related RSS feed I can think of is
627:
561:
454:
376:
348:
637:
234:
655:
506:
474:
236:
840:
821:
739:
723:
699:
611:
595:
573:
344:
332:
293:
251:
95:
230:
91:
825:
806:
685:
681:
623:
556:
449:
386:
371:
62:
651:
502:
483:
470:
441:
281:
97:
111:
326:
303:
287:
232:
93:
237:
98:
15:
776:). I'm not sure what's the process for the new subpage
647:
105:
56:
265:Idle thought (and probably bad idea) I'll put here
780:is supposed to be. It was added to the template
273:500 AND page_namespace = 2 ORDER BY page_latest;
802:the advertised improvements are implemented.
246:New, improved, updated, revamped, etc scripts
343:Where do we currently get our scripts from?
531:Hi, would it be worth listing entries like
772:and cleaned up some wikitext (see these
768:I finished the publishing process for
674:meta:Planet Wikimedia#How do I get in?
720:Category:Knowledge Scripts++ issues
13:
786:Special:Diff/1192472634/1208916860
555:or something along those lines. ―
14:
862:
614:, list of featured scripts is at
347:and watchers of this talk page? –
110:
61:
416:User:Awesome Aasim/customsearch
408:User:Ahecht/Scripts/ReadingMode
1:
590:List of all featured scripts?
584:15:27, 29 December 2023 (UTC)
567:09:47, 27 December 2021 (UTC)
511:16:56, 27 December 2021 (UTC)
496:06:27, 27 December 2021 (UTC)
479:00:51, 27 December 2021 (UTC)
460:20:19, 26 December 2021 (UTC)
436:17:50, 26 December 2021 (UTC)
404:User:Enterprisey/set-js-prefs
395:Infobox Knowledge user script
382:17:07, 26 December 2021 (UTC)
363:17:05, 26 December 2021 (UTC)
337:00:54, 27 December 2021 (UTC)
316:13:58, 26 December 2021 (UTC)
298:01:34, 26 December 2021 (UTC)
20:
770:Knowledge:Scripts++/Issue 25
632:23:09, 25 January 2024 (UTC)
606:21:49, 25 January 2024 (UTC)
420:User:Awesome Aasim/savedraft
7:
793:Knowledge:Scripts++/Improve
778:Knowledge:Scripts++/Improve
762:Knowledge:Scripts++/Improve
444:who reverted me doing this
276:You'd need to JOIN it with
10:
867:
851:13:18, 1 August 2024 (UTC)
834:08:16, 1 August 2024 (UTC)
815:06:57, 1 August 2024 (UTC)
750:13:47, 1 August 2024 (UTC)
734:13:41, 1 August 2024 (UTC)
710:13:37, 1 August 2024 (UTC)
667:meta:Talk:Planet Wikimedia
412:Knowledge:Shortdesc helper
368:Category:Knowledge scripts
249:
782:Knowledge:Scripts++/Shell
694:17:14, 26 July 2024 (UTC)
660:04:03, 26 July 2024 (UTC)
322:User:JPxG/Monthcounter.js
26:
19:
644:Knowledge:Scripts++/Next
424:Knowledge:WikidataLinker
260:18:51, 5 July 2019 (UTC)
280:and do some stuff like
805:What do you think? —
839:second paragraph.
620::Scripts++/Archive
550:
361:
243:
242:
117:Issue discussions
104:
103:
85:
84:
54:
53:
858:
843:
742:
726:
702:
648:Planet Wikimedia
598:
576:
564:
559:
544:
535:
527:Script installer
489:
468:
457:
452:
429:
399:
393:
379:
374:
355:
353:
309:
279:
238:
114:
106:
99:
76:
75:
65:
57:
17:
16:
866:
865:
861:
860:
859:
857:
856:
855:
841:
820:Forgot to ping
797:before blanking
766:
740:
724:
718:, it relies on
700:
640:
596:
592:
574:
562:
557:
533:
529:
487:
466:
455:
450:
427:
397:
391:
377:
372:
349:
307:
277:
274:
267:
262:
248:
239:
233:
119:
100:
94:
70:
55:
50:
22:
12:
11:
5:
864:
854:
853:
836:
822:User:Aaron Liu
801:
765:
758:
757:
756:
755:
754:
753:
752:
696:
670:
646:go out on the
639:
638:/Next sent out
636:
635:
634:
591:
588:
587:
586:
553:
552:
551:– Description.
536:
532:
528:
525:
524:
523:
522:
521:
520:
519:
518:
517:
516:
515:
514:
513:
365:
341:
340:
339:
271:
266:
263:
247:
244:
241:
240:
235:
231:
229:
226:
225:
204:
164:
121:
120:
115:
109:
102:
101:
96:
92:
90:
87:
86:
83:
82:
72:
71:
66:
60:
52:
51:
49:
48:
43:
38:
33:
27:
24:
23:
9:
6:
4:
3:
2:
863:
852:
848:
844:
837:
835:
831:
827:
823:
819:
818:
817:
816:
812:
808:
803:
799:
798:
794:
789:
787:
783:
779:
775:
771:
763:
751:
747:
743:
737:
736:
735:
731:
727:
721:
717:
713:
712:
711:
707:
703:
697:
695:
691:
687:
683:
679:
675:
671:
668:
664:
663:
662:
661:
657:
653:
649:
645:
633:
629:
625:
621:
619:
613:
610:
609:
608:
607:
603:
599:
585:
581:
577:
571:
570:
569:
568:
565:
560:
548:
543:
540:
539:
538:
512:
508:
504:
499:
498:
497:
493:
485:
482:
481:
480:
476:
472:
463:
462:
461:
458:
453:
447:
443:
439:
438:
437:
433:
425:
421:
417:
413:
409:
405:
401:
396:
388:
385:
384:
383:
380:
375:
369:
366:
364:
359:
354:
352:
351:Novem Linguae
346:
342:
338:
335:
334:
329:
328:
323:
319:
318:
317:
313:
305:
302:
301:
300:
299:
296:
295:
290:
289:
283:
270:
261:
257:
253:
228:
227:
224:
223:
219:
215:
211:
207:
203:
199:
195:
191:
187:
183:
179:
175:
171:
167:
163:
159:
155:
151:
147:
143:
139:
135:
131:
127:
123:
122:
118:
113:
108:
107:
89:
88:
81:
78:
77:
74:
73:
69:
64:
59:
58:
47:
44:
42:
39:
37:
34:
32:
29:
28:
25:
18:
804:
790:
767:
760:Process for
716:the Git repo
641:
617:
593:
554:
530:
494:or ping me)
467:hastemplate:
434:or ping me)
390:
350:
331:
325:
314:or ping me)
292:
286:
275:
268:
124:
116:
67:
35:
714:As seen in
488:Alexis Jazz
428:Alexis Jazz
308:Alexis Jazz
791:I blanked
616:Knowledge
537:producing
842:Aaron Liu
741:Aaron Liu
725:Aaron Liu
701:Aaron Liu
680:, as per
612:Aaron Liu
597:Aaron Liu
575:Aaron Liu
440:Pinging @
252:DannyS712
80:Archive 1
41:Subscribe
21:Scripts++
826:andrybak
807:andrybak
774:14 edits
686:andrybak
642:Why did
624:andrybak
558:Qwerfjkl
451:Qwerfjkl
387:Qwerfjkl
373:Qwerfjkl
278:revision
68:Archives
542:example
345:WP:US/L
46:Archive
36:Discuss
682:WP:RSS
652:Nardog
650:feed?
547:source
503:Nardog
484:Nardog
471:Nardog
442:Nardog
800:until
847:talk
830:talk
824:. —
811:talk
746:talk
730:talk
706:talk
690:talk
684:. —
672:Per
656:talk
628:talk
622:. —
618:talk
602:talk
580:talk
563:talk
507:talk
492:talk
475:talk
456:talk
448:. ―
446:here
432:talk
426:. —
422:and
378:talk
370:? ―
358:talk
312:talk
304:JPxG
282:this
256:talk
31:Home
784:in
849:)
832:)
813:)
788:.
748:)
732:)
722:.
708:)
692:)
658:)
630:)
604:)
582:)
509:)
477:)
469:?
418:,
414:,
410:,
406:,
398:}}
392:{{
389:,
327:jp
288:jp
258:)
222:25
220:,
218:24
216:,
214:23
212:,
210:22
208:,
206:21
202:20
200:,
198:19
196:,
194:18
192:,
190:17
188:,
186:16
184:,
182:15
180:,
178:14
176:,
174:13
172:,
170:12
168:,
166:11
162:10
160:,
156:,
152:,
148:,
144:,
140:,
136:,
132:,
128:,
845:(
828:(
809:(
764:?
744:(
728:(
704:(
688:(
669:.
654:(
626:(
600:(
578:(
549:)
545:(
505:(
490:(
473:(
430:(
360:)
356:(
333:g
330:×
310:(
294:g
291:×
254:(
158:9
154:8
150:7
146:6
142:5
138:4
134:3
130:2
126:1
Text is available under the Creative Commons Attribution-ShareAlike License. Additional terms may apply.